PRACTICAL STEREOLOGICAL METHODS FOR MORPHOMETRIC CYTOLOGY
The Journal of Cell Biology · 1966 · Vol. 30(1) · pp. 23–38
Ewald R. Weibel✉(University of Zurich)G. Kistler(University of Zurich)W Scherle(University of Zurich)
Abstract
Stereological principles provide efficient and reliable tools for the determination of quantitative parameters of tissue structure on sections. Some principles which allow the estimation of volumetric ratios, surface areas, surface-to-volume ratios, thicknesses of tissue or cell sheets, and the number of structures are reviewed and presented in general form; means for their practical application in electron microscopy are outlined. The systematic and statistical errors involved in such measurements are discussed.
